Many people don't know Seattle was rebuilt after the Great Fire of 1889, and that a forgotten city with abandoned storefronts and sidewalks remains entombed underground. A 75-minute guided walking tour begins beneath Doc Maynard’s Public House, then spills into historic Pioneer Square, Seattle’s birthplace. You are then transported to another time and place as you explore the abandoned underground city. Guides tell humorous stories as they tell you about the history of the underground city.
